隐匿在升级后的崩溃:TP钱包闪退的系统性剖析

手机升级后的第一刻并非总是喜悦。针对TP钱包在系统升级后闪退的问题,我以数据分析流程拆解问题、验证假设并给出可操作建议。

第一步,收集症状与环境变量:系统版本、TP客户端版本、设备型号、崩溃日志(ANR、崩溃堆栈)、最近一次数据迁移记录。样本分析(n=120)显示,37%与ABI/库不兼容、28%与RPC节点连接超时相关、18%与本地数据库迁移失败有关。

第二步,复现与隔离:在受控机群上重放升级路径,使用符号化崩溃堆栈定位函数级别异常;对比旧版与新版依赖库的符号表,定位第三方SDK冲突。若问题与DB迁移相关,建议先导出钱包助记词/私钥并做离线备份,再执行回滚,避免因迁移失败导致数据损失。

数据保护方面,强调端到端加密备份、助记词硬件化存放与分片备份策略。针对DAI及ERC-20资产,需校验代币合约索引和事件同步:错误的Token metadata或事件索引中断会在渲染或余额计算环节触发未捕获异常。

安全身份验证建议采用设备指纹+多因素机制,并在签名流程引入可恢复的用户确认层,避免升级后授权失效导致的自动签名异常。高效能市场应用需关注签名延迟(目标<200ms)、RPC重试与本地缓存策略,以减少网络波动引发的崩溃概率。

前沿趋势指出,账户抽象(AA)、多方计算(Mhttps://www.dsbjrobot.com ,PC)、可信执行环境(TEE)与可证明的回滚机制将降低升级带来的兼容风险。行业观察显示,移动端碎片化和第三方SDK频繁迭代是主要风险源,治理依赖和强化回归测试能产生明显收益。

结论很直接:通过标准化数据采集、受控复现、先备份再迁移和严格依赖管理,短期内可将类似闪退事件下降约50%。技术修复与流程改进并重,才能把一次升级变为一次能力提升。

作者:林辰发布时间:2025-12-15 09:31:05

评论

Neo

文章的复现与隔离步骤很实用,尤其是先导出助记词再回滚的建议。

小林

关于DAI的事件索引问题提醒到位,我这次升级就碰到类似的代币显示异常。

River

提到AA和MPC很前瞻,期待钱包厂商尽快落地这些技术以降低风险。

区块链侠

数据和流程并重是关键,尤其在移动端碎片化环境下,依赖治理太重要了。

相关阅读